Output 923b6883974d9fbbc3f0ae112c4ab9d1a1069c18d6dc5632819ab50b63f64b87:11

value
86960596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e84db9acbc1be036ba55698c8fedbfaf97a13d OP_EQUAL
address
MJebacUWh3Rh9ePRFpQ7SsNfvzmZZGZtuX
transaction
923b6883974d9fbbc3f0ae112c4ab9d1a1069c18d6dc5632819ab50b63f64b87
spent
true